"Louis Braille" by Emma Bassier tells the inspiring story of a young boy who, after losing his sight at a tender age, refuses to let his disability define him. Driven by a passion for learning and a determination to help others, Louis invents a revolutionary system of reading and writing for the blind using a series of raised dots. The narrative captures his struggles, triumphs, and the profound impact of his creation, which transforms the lives of countless individuals with visual impairments.
